The Community Improvement Grant is designed to help neighborhoods and businesses address community issues, and to support non-profit organizations that provide services to Stayton residents.

The grant program is intended to fund items such as landscape improvements, neighborhood clean-up parties, installation of benches, murals, or other improvements that might address a neighborhood or community concern.
Objectives
The funds may be used by applicants for programs and projects in the following categories. Grant applications may include components of any or all of the categories. No category is prioritized higher than another for receiving funding.
- Neighborhood Improvement Projects – The funds may be used to improve the shared space within a neighborhood or strengthen neighborhood identity. This may include items such as landscape improvements and maintenance, signage, natural features management, benches, painting, or certain exterior improvements.

- Neighborhood Quality of Life Initiatives – Funds may be used to provide education and outreach opportunities that strengthen the social connections in a neighborhood, increase safety, address a neighborhood challenge or conflict, or serve senior or low-income residents, and programs that provide services to Stayton residents.
- Local Business Development – Funds may also be allocated to enhance local business properties by improving infrastructure, accessibility, and overall maintenance.
Funding Information
Grant amounts should not exceed $5,000.
Eligibility Criteria
Non-profit tax-exempt organizations, business owners or groups of at least three community members may apply for funding for projects that benefit a clearly defined geographic area within Stayton city limits. A group of neighbors must authorize one individual to manage the grant contracts and funds.
Review Criteria
- Extent to which organizational, neighborhood, and quality of life objectives are addressed within Stayton.
- The number of people benefiting from the proposal.
- Demonstrated level of support in terms of matching funds and/or in-kind contributions (volunteers or donations) and funding need.
